Due to the confluence of different circumstances, at the end of the decade of 1860 an extraordinary interest in prehistory and protohistory and in archaeological remains of those historical periods as collecting objects aroused in Spain. The Rotondo y Nicolau brothers were also under this cultural influence and grew this hobby all their lives long. This drove them to disciplines as geology, archaeology or history, about which they also proposed other initiatives, apart from collecting. This paper is a biography of the brothers in relation to these activities, aspect scarcely studied before. Because of this reason, the investigation is mainly based in the analysis of unpublished documents.Downloads
